Stay Stylish and Sustainable: Sustainable Fashion Tips
In a world where environmental consciousness is gaining importance, sustainable fashion has become a significant trend. It’s not only about looking good but also about making eco-friendly choices. Here are some tips to help you stay stylish while supporting sustainability:
1. Buy Second-Hand
Shopping for second-hand or vintage clothing is a great way to reduce waste and support sustainable fashion. You can find unique pieces that not only make a style statement but also help the environment by giving pre-loved items a new life.
2. Choose Quality Over Quantity
Invest in high-quality, timeless pieces that will last longer and withstand trends. By buying fewer items of better quality, you can reduce the need for frequent replacements and contribute to a more sustainable fashion industry.
3. Opt for Organic and Eco-Friendly Fabrics
Look for clothing made from organic cotton, linen, hemp, or other eco-friendly materials. These fabrics are produced using sustainable practices that minimize environmental impact and are often more comfortable to wear.
4. Support Sustainable Brands
Research and choose to support fashion brands that prioritize sustainability in their production processes. These brands often use ethical practices, recycle materials, and reduce waste, ensuring that your fashion choices have a positive impact on the planet.
5. Repurpose and Upcycle
Get creative with your wardrobe by repurposing old clothes or upcycling them into new pieces. This not only adds a unique touch to your style but also reduces textile waste and promotes a circular fashion economy.
6. Care for Your Clothes
Extend the lifespan of your garments by following proper care instructions. Wash clothes in cold water, air dry when possible, and mend any damages to keep your wardrobe looking fresh and lasting longer.
